The legendary band recently put on a show-stopping performance, leaving supporters—both in person and online—in awe of how their iconic hits transcend time. On June 15, the musical ensemble—including founding and sole surviving original memberRobert "Kool" Bell, along withMichael Ray,Curtis "Curt" Williams, and more—brought their timeless funk and soul to Paris, delivering a vibrant, 2½‑hour performance at La Seine Musicale that had fans dancing from start to finish. The group, whose career stretches back to 1969 and includes hits like "Celebration," "Jungle Boogie," "Summer Madness," and "Cherish," proved they still know how to command a stage. First apprehensive, the venue's personnel got into the musical spirit and obliged the artist by singing a few lines of the track's chorus, bashfully shaking his head and smiling afterward. In the comment section of a clip of the moment posted on TikTok, glowing reactions reflected widespread admiration for not only the show, but also the notable and fun gesture of inclusion. "Good vibes," one said, while another commended, "Absolutely love Kool and Gang and his gesture and the way he treated the security." A third presumed, "you made his day," as an additional comment dubbed the band "Still Kool as ever, wow wow 🔥🔥." Yet another fan insisted the show was rated a "20/20." Paris was just one stop on theSummer Madness 2025tour, which continues across Europe throughout the season. With shows lined up in Prague, Madrid, Milan, Lyon, and more, the band is riding a wave of renewed interest and cross-generational excitement.
